The Evolution of Popular Italian Supercar The Ferrari

Enzo Ferrari is the man behind the classic red and yellow machine that everybody knows the name of. He was an innovator. Here is a brief look at the evolution of his brand throughout the years.

1947 125 S

V12 1.49 L
118 HP
1433 Lbs
124 MPH
10.8 0-60

1969 Dino 246 GT

V6 2.4 L
192 HP
2380 Lbs
146 mph
7.1 0-60

1984 288 GTO

V8 2.85 L
400 HP
2557 Lbs
189 mph
4.9 0-60

1984 Testarossa

V12 4.9 L
390 HP
3320 lbs
178 mph
5.2 0-60

1987 F40

V8 2.9 L
471 HP
2425 lbs
201 mph
3.8 0-60

1995 F50

V12 4.7 L
520 HP
2711 lbs
202 mph
3.6 0-60

1999 360 Modena

V8 3.6 L
400 HP
2843 lbs
183 mph
4.3 0-60

2003 Enzo

V12 6.0 L
660 HP
3009 lbs
218 mph
3.1 0-60

2004 F430

V8 4.3 L
483 HP
3350 lbs
196 mph
3.6 0-60

2010 599 GTO

V12 6.0 L
661 HP
3850 lbs
208 mph
3.1 0-60

2012 458 Italia

V8 4.5 L
562 HP
3274 lbs
202 mph
3.0 0-60

2014 LaFerrari

V12 6.3 L
960 HP
2767 lbs
212 mph
2.4 0-60

2017 812 Superfast

V12 6.5 L
789 HP
3362 lbs
221 mph
2.9 0-60
